Gender Parity The Asean Post Overall, the asean gender outlook 2024 aims to provide valuable insights and data to help policymakers accelerate progress towards gender equality and the empowerment of women and girls in the region. The ams individually and collectively have been active, however, and have responded to the challenge of addressing gender inequality.2 at the national and whole community level there have been many documents, declarations, and strategies adopted that reference gender equality.3 in the post 2015 era, the 2017 action agenda on mainstreaming women. Gender focal points (gfp)–proposed to be composed of individuals from asean sectoral bodies and the asean secretariat who will be appointed to encourage and drive actions at the sectoral body level, including supporting the development of gender and inclusion work plans, among others. Asean gender mainstreaming strategic framework 2021–2025 in 2022. as highlighted in these documents, stakeholders in the region are implementing the vision of a true – and equal – asean community. notably, there should be a more focus on the integration of women into decision making processes. The asean gender outlook 2024 is the second edition of this series. produced jointly by un women and the asean secretariat, in close consultation with asean member states, it highlights differences in progress for each of the sdgs for women and men.
